Output e40ccd4e02eede81d9093d813f470a7c1935796789b060a8f5b41aa78b924c0a:0

value
326318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0af614ebe54c413d1ca4236f1bc507ca34af22e OP_EQUAL
address
3HoEwvrqYRnrizFN7gTg5ouSbV3Tek9pab
transaction
e40ccd4e02eede81d9093d813f470a7c1935796789b060a8f5b41aa78b924c0a
confirmations
182764
spent
true